How do I know if I need to see a urologist like Dr. Adamu?

You should consider scheduling a urology appointment if you experience symptoms such as painful urination, blood in the urine, frequent nighttime urination, difficulty urinating, or flank pain. Early evaluation can identify the cause and prevent complications. Your primary care physician can also provide a referral if needed.
